- The Miami Heat’s mascot was reportedly taken to the hospital Friday night after getting punched by former UFC champion Conor McGregor in a skit in the team’s NBA finals game against the Denver Nuggets.
- The male who plays Heat mascot, Burnie, was reportedly taken to the emergency room at a nearby hospital after McGregor hit him in his costume head, sending him to the floor.
- The man reportedly receiving pain medication and is recovering at home.
- The skit was to promote a pain relief spray.
